diff --git a/frontend/admin/src/App.vue b/frontend/admin/src/App.vue index ff31edc..135ccba 100644 --- a/frontend/admin/src/App.vue +++ b/frontend/admin/src/App.vue @@ -3,51 +3,69 @@ diff --git a/frontend/admin/src/components/TopLead.vue b/frontend/admin/src/components/TopLead.vue index 3838dc3..7c1db35 100644 --- a/frontend/admin/src/components/TopLead.vue +++ b/frontend/admin/src/components/TopLead.vue @@ -78,7 +78,14 @@
- + + +
+ + + + @@ -114,12 +131,14 @@ import {onMounted, ref} from "vue"; import OcImagePicker from "@/components/OcImagePicker.vue"; import {apiGet} from "@/utils/http.js"; import ResetCacheBtn from "@/components/Form/ResetCacheBtn.vue"; -import {Button, ButtonGroup} from "primevue"; +import {Button, ButtonGroup, Drawer} from "primevue"; import {rub} from "@/utils/helpers.js"; +import LogsViewer from "@/components/LogsViewer.vue"; const settings = useSettingsStore(); const stats = useStatsStore(); const tgMe = ref(null); +const showLogsDrawer = ref(false); onMounted(async () => { await stats.fetchStats(); diff --git a/frontend/admin/src/router/index.js b/frontend/admin/src/router/index.js index 1d77fba..cf83413 100644 --- a/frontend/admin/src/router/index.js +++ b/frontend/admin/src/router/index.js @@ -6,7 +6,6 @@ import TelegramView from "@/views/TelegramView.vue"; import MetricsView from "@/views/MetricsView.vue"; import StoreView from "@/views/StoreView.vue"; import MainPageView from "@/views/MainPageView.vue"; -import LogsView from "@/views/LogsView.vue"; import FormBuilderView from "@/views/FormBuilderView.vue"; import CustomersView from "@/views/CustomersView.vue"; import TeleCartPulseView from "@/views/TeleCartPulseView.vue"; @@ -18,7 +17,6 @@ const router = createRouter({ {path: '/', name: 'general', component: GeneralView}, {path: '/customers', name: 'customers', component: CustomersView}, {path: '/formbuilder', name: 'formbuilder', component: FormBuilderView}, - {path: '/logs', name: 'logs', component: LogsView}, {path: '/mainpage', name: 'mainpage', component: MainPageView}, {path: '/metrics', name: 'metrics', component: MetricsView}, {path: '/orders', name: 'orders', component: OrdersView},